But even beyond Shadow, Sonic has a plethora of other friends and foes for us to meet. Thankfully, IDW Publishing has made this task easier with their comic book universe, which began in 2018.
The only main title is Sonic the Hedgehog, but a few characters received their spotlights in miniseries. One recent example is Chasing Shadows, which focuses (clearly) on Shadow. With our reading order, you can get the full Sonic experience!
Note that the comic is canon and takes place in the game chronology. It is set after Sonic Forces, a 2017 game in which Doctor Eggman—the hedgehog’s main villain—has conquered most of the world.
But even if you’ve never played the game, you can get up to speed quick — just like Sonic — with our Sonic the Hedgehog reading order for the IDW comic books.

Sonic the Hedgehog: Scrapnik Island TP

Writer: Daniel Barnes
Artist: Jack Lawrence
Not only the best miniseries on the list but one of the greatest Sonic storylines in general. Sonic and Tails find themselves on Scrapnik Island, a isle packed with evil robots created and discarded by Eggman. Can they escape their programming or are they doomed to follow it forever?
